Clinical Physiotherapy is a great course at Coventry. Members of staff are on hand whenever you need them.The level of group work can be daunting at first but it is extremely valuable and provides you with skills along the way that you didn't realise you were picking up, there are also some extremely high marks to be earnt if you give enough time and effort to it. You will be presented with three different cases of diseases based around the respiratory system, cardiovascular system along with a final neurophysiological section.You will be assessed for each. The first is summative and consists of a presentation, second is formative and a presentation along with a full scientific leaflet, finally a A1 poster presentation presented in an open area of the university to your tutors along with anyone else who choses to join such as the head of school or the dean. This module can be very enjoyable and fulfilling with physical proof at the end of our hard work. Marks and feedback are also release extremely quickly which is always a positive thing!
